Petersburg: Christmas Market

On Saturday, December 10 at the Christmas Market, there will be great items to choose from for your holiday menus, home decor and gifts, activities for all ages powered by the POP [Power of Produce] Club, and live music performed by Flutist Iris Schwartz and The Legendary Dave and Cole band.

After you finish spreading Christmas cheer, experience the shops and restaurants of Old Towne and visit two other holiday events.

Check out the "Trees of Christmas" exhibit at the recently renovated Petersburg Area Art League [PAAL], one block away from the market. As a fundraiser for PAAL, over 30 locals designed wreaths to sell to support the Arts in Petersburg.

Walk or drive one-half mile from the Christmas Market to see Centre Hill Mansion/Museum's Holiday Showcase. Rooms in the historic home have been decorated by area designers, businesses, garden clubs and a synagogue.

The River Street Market is a blend of arts, produce and culture. Produce is harvested from surrounding counties and often picked each market morning. The producers-only arts and produce market offers fresh produce, nuts, handmade jewelry, honey, jams, fresh meats, eggs, soaps, baked goods, plants, clothing, specialty drinks, pet items and more.

Rain or shine, join in on the excitement between 9 a.m. and noon at 30 River Street in Petersburg across the street from the iconic Farmers Market Building.
